Its opened up a whole new world for me. Some breaking developments today out of the g20 summit, russian president Vladimir Putin telling reporters to deal with the u. S. To quote unquote ease tensions in syria could come in days. This after a 90minute meeting with president obama who said the discussion was candid, blunt, business like. Obama seemed to have a more cautious take on whether a deal could be reached. We have had productive conversations about what a real cessation of hostilities would look like that would allow the eyes and russia to focus on common enemies like isil and nusra. But given the gaps of trust that exist thats a tough negotiatio negotiation. On that last note, knowing putin said days thats a mighty confident statement. Yeah, look, what president putin is doing here and what weve heard over the days running up to the g20 was russians putting forward a more positive spin saying it was close, it was possible the United States, we heard from president obama, secretary kerry had been more cautious on this. The russians have created the optics where theyre in the driving seat, this is up to time if they deliver the sort of terms and conditions that the United States can agree to for some kind of cessation of hostilities and the reality is if we look at what russia has done since the peace talks for syria started in geneva back in january, those talks keep having to go on hold because russia continues along with Bashar Al Assad forces to try to surround that city, take control of the rebel areas and guess what . Were still in the same place, stop start stop start on the talks. Just yesterday once again Russian Forces along with president Bashar Al Assads forces surrounded rebels in the city of aleppo and here president putin is saying a deal is around the conner. Hes putting himself in the position of being on the world stage saying aunt deal, deal with me on other issues, ukraine is one of those issues, he wants sanctions lift there had, economic sanctions for innovating and annexing crimea.
